1 2 3 4 UNITED STATES DISTRICT COURT 5 DISTRICT OF NEVADA 6 7 EMERY SLAYDEN, 8 9 10 Petitioner, vs. E.K. McDANIEL, et al., 11 Respondents. ) ) ) ) ) ) ) ) ) / 2:06-cv-0664-PMP-RJJ ORDER 12 13 Emery Slayden, a Nevada prisoner, has filed a Motion for Complete Copy of Records (ECF 14 No. 25) in anticipation of a renewed appeal effort on the basis of actual innocence. He has also 15 recently provided a signed copy of the supporting Declaration of Ted L. Gunderson, private 16 investigator of Gunderson and Associates located in Los Angeles, California, (ECF No. 26), dated 17 October 9, 2011. The Court notes that petitioner, in violation of the Court’s rules, has failed to serve 18 a copy of his motion upon respondents. See LR 5-1. 19 The Declaration from Mr. Gunderson which sets out his license number and social security 20 number (another violation of Court Special Order 108) indicates Gunderson’s plans to obtain Sandy 21 Doram’s affidavit upon his return from Panama in December, 2011. The Declaration causes the 22 Court some concern, as the Court was under the impression that Mr. Gunderson had recently passed 23 away. Therefore, respondents shall be required to file a response to the motion and shall confirm for 24 the Court whether or not Mr. Gunderson is, in fact, alive. 25 /// 26 /// 1 2 3 IT IS THEREFORE ORDERED that the Clerk shall serve the motion and declaration upon respondents. IT IS FURTHER ORDERED that the respondents shall, within thirty days of entry of this 4 Order, file a response to the Motion for Complete Record which shall also confirm for the Court Mr. 5 Gunderson’s status. 6 7 DATED: October 20, 2011. 8 9 10 PHILIP M.
